Output e17c6612c3784f4e62fcf9a40f1e18539a5cc2b7b8f49b1c1490b06c3252cd83:0

value
272528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c27d0fa7b6e6e0861ef11aaef14fa8f08e6994 OP_EQUAL
address
3CRfyHcNwa6SipE4DKy8PRqGRvLAsj4RCd
transaction
e17c6612c3784f4e62fcf9a40f1e18539a5cc2b7b8f49b1c1490b06c3252cd83
spent
true